- [ ] FareForge rules-engine signing key rotation (weekly eng sync). Before the ceremony, confirm the shipping-fee rules engine has drained its evaluation queue and the Tallowmere staging replica matches production rule versions. Two custodians from the Pricing Guild must witness the HSM unseal, and the old key stays valid for 48 hours to cover in-flight fee calculations. Record witness initials in the ceremony log and verify the checksum of the exported rule bundle. The recovery passphrase for the escrow shard is recorded directly below.

unlock words, fawif-hahip: eliax-ulador-holdor-novix-prawyn-norius-kelax-weniel-alddor-ulaion

## Local setup

So, the infamous N+1: the Quillfeed GraphQL API was firing one query per comment author, and a big thread meant ~400 round trips. The fix lives in `loaders/` — we batch author lookups through a dataloader now. If you're on call and latency spikes, check that the loader cache is actually enabled (`BATCH_LOADERS=true`). To reproduce locally, seed a thread with `make seed-bigthread` and watch the query log. The seeder and the app both talk to the local database via the connection string below.

primary connection of yagag-kaguf = mssql://praox_svc:wUPY5WS@db-c12a.sivrelio.corp:5432/gordor

Welcome to the Slabview team. Slabview is our diff viewer tuned for very large files; it streams hunks instead of loading whole blobs, so multi-gigabyte diffs stay responsive. Release managers should confirm DIFF_CHUNK_SIZE and DIFF_MAX_STREAMS match the values in the release checklist before each cut. The viewer also talks to the artifact store, which requires a credential set in the env file on the next line.

sealed setting: LEDGER_TOKEN13=b4a1a6f880cb4

Ticket: Staging env misconfigured for Siftgate bloom filter

The bloom layer in front of the Pellet KV store is rejecting all lookups in staging because the env file was copied from the dev template without credentials. False-positive tuning values are fine; only the auth line is missing. To unblock the weekly demo, the Pellet admission secret must be set on the following line.

env line for yaguf-fajop: LEDGER_TOKEN13=fb08984397349